数据库中修改数据的语句是什么
-
在数据库中,修改数据的语句是UPDATE语句。通过UPDATE语句,可以更新数据库表中的一条或多条记录的数据。
UPDATE语句的基本语法如下: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;其中,table_name是要更新数据的表名,column1、column2等是要更新的字段名,value1、value2等是要更新的字段值,condition是更新条件。
下面是关于UPDATE语句的一些重要说明:
-
SET子句:SET子句用于指定要更新的字段和对应的新值。可以同时更新多个字段,每个字段和新值之间使用等号(=)进行连接。如果要更新的值是字符串类型,需要使用单引号或双引号将其括起来。
-
WHERE子句:WHERE子句用于指定更新数据的条件。只有满足条件的记录才会被更新。可以使用比较运算符(如=、<、>等)和逻辑运算符(如AND、OR等)来构建条件。
-
更新多条记录:UPDATE语句可以更新一条或多条记录。如果不指定WHERE子句,将会更新表中的所有记录。
-
返回受影响的行数:执行UPDATE语句后,可以使用ROW_COUNT()函数获取被更新的记录数量。
-
注意事项:在使用UPDATE语句时,需要谨慎操作,特别是在没有指定WHERE子句的情况下。如果不小心执行了更新所有记录的操作,可能会导致数据丢失或错误。
总结起来,UPDATE语句是数据库中用于修改数据的重要语句。通过指定要更新的表名、字段名、新值和更新条件,可以实现对数据库表中记录的灵活修改。在使用UPDATE语句时,需要注意条件的准确性,避免误操作导致数据的不可逆性修改。
1年前 -
-
在数据库中,修改数据的语句是使用UPDATE语句。UPDATE语句用于更新表中的数据,可以修改单个记录或多个记录。
UPDATE语句的基本语法如下:
UPDATE 表名 SET 列名1 = 值1, 列名2 = 值2, ... WHERE 条件;其中,表名是要修改数据的表的名称,列名是要修改的列的名称,值是要将列更新为的新值,条件是一个可选的WHERE子句,用于指定要修改的记录。
下面是一个示例,假设有一个名为students的表,包含id、name和age三列,我们要将id为1的记录的name修改为"Tom",age修改为20:
UPDATE students SET name = 'Tom', age = 20 WHERE id = 1;如果不指定WHERE子句,UPDATE语句将会更新表中的所有记录。
除了直接指定值,我们还可以使用表达式来更新数据。例如,可以使用加法、减法等算术运算符更新数值列,使用拼接符号更新字符串列等。
另外,UPDATE语句还支持使用子查询来更新数据。例如,可以使用子查询来获取要更新的值。
总之,使用UPDATE语句可以在数据库中修改数据,通过指定表名、列名、新值和条件,可以精确地更新表中的记录。
1年前 -
在数据库中,修改数据的语句是UPDATE语句。UPDATE语句用于修改表中的现有记录。它可以更新一个或多个字段的值,也可以根据指定的条件来更新记录。
下面是使用UPDATE语句修改数据的一般操作流程:
-
确定要修改的表和字段:首先,确定要修改的表和需要更新的字段。表名和字段名应该与数据库中的实际情况一致。
-
写UPDATE语句:根据需要修改的字段和条件,编写UPDATE语句。UPDATE语句的基本语法如下:
UPDATE table_name SET column1 = value1, column2 = value2, ... WHERE condition;在SET子句中,指定要更新的字段和对应的新值。在WHERE子句中,指定更新记录的条件。
-
执行UPDATE语句:使用数据库客户端工具或编程语言的数据库接口,执行UPDATE语句。根据不同的数据库系统和工具,执行UPDATE语句的方法可能有所不同。
-
检查更新结果:执行UPDATE语句后,可以通过执行SELECT语句来验证更新结果。SELECT语句可以检索修改后的数据,以确认更新操作是否成功。
下面是一个具体的例子,演示如何使用UPDATE语句修改数据库中的数据:
假设有一个名为"employees"的表,包含以下字段:id, name, age, email。现在要将id为1的员工的姓名修改为"John Smith",年龄修改为30,电子邮件修改为"john.smith@example.com"。
-
确定要修改的表和字段:表名为"employees",需要更新的字段为"name"、"age"和"email"。
-
写UPDATE语句:根据上述要求,编写UPDATE语句如下:
UPDATE employees SET name = 'John Smith', age = 30, email = 'john.smith@example.com' WHERE id = 1; -
执行UPDATE语句:通过数据库客户端工具或编程语言的数据库接口执行UPDATE语句。
-
检查更新结果:执行SELECT语句,检索id为1的员工记录,验证更新操作是否成功。
这是一个基本的修改数据的操作流程。根据实际情况,可以根据需要修改的字段和条件,灵活地编写UPDATE语句来修改数据库中的数据。
1年前 -